Afbeelding kan een representatie zijn.
Zie specificaties voor productdetails.
LM3S617-IGZ50-C2T

LM3S617-IGZ50-C2T

Product Overview

Category

The LM3S617-IGZ50-C2T belongs to the category of microcontrollers.

Use

This microcontroller is commonly used in various electronic devices and systems for controlling and processing data.

Characteristics

  • High-performance 32-bit ARM Cortex-M3 core
  • Clock speed of up to 50 MHz
  • Flash memory capacity of 128 KB
  • RAM capacity of 32 KB
  • Low power consumption
  • Wide operating voltage range
  • Multiple communication interfaces (UART, SPI, I2C)
  • Analog-to-digital converter (ADC) with multiple channels
  • Real-time clock (RTC) functionality
  • Integrated Ethernet MAC controller

Package

The LM3S617-IGZ50-C2T is available in a compact package, suitable for surface mount technology (SMT) assembly.

Essence

The essence of the LM3S617-IGZ50-C2T lies in its ability to provide high-performance computing capabilities in a small form factor, making it ideal for embedded systems.

Packaging/Quantity

This microcontroller is typically packaged in reels or trays, with quantities varying based on customer requirements.

Specifications

  • Microcontroller: LM3S617
  • Core: ARM Cortex-M3
  • Clock Speed: Up to 50 MHz
  • Flash Memory: 128 KB
  • RAM: 32 KB
  • Operating Voltage: 2.7V - 3.6V
  • Communication Interfaces: UART, SPI, I2C
  • ADC Channels: Multiple
  • Ethernet MAC Controller: Integrated

Detailed Pin Configuration

The LM3S617-IGZ50-C2T has a total of 64 pins, which are assigned for various functions such as power supply, input/output, communication, and control. The detailed pin configuration can be found in the product datasheet.

Functional Features

  • High-performance computing capabilities
  • Efficient power management
  • Multiple communication interfaces for data exchange
  • Analog-to-digital conversion for sensor interfacing
  • Real-time clock functionality for time-sensitive applications
  • Integrated Ethernet MAC controller for network connectivity

Advantages and Disadvantages

Advantages

  • High processing power with ARM Cortex-M3 core
  • Low power consumption for energy-efficient designs
  • Versatile communication interfaces for easy integration
  • Ample flash memory and RAM capacity for data storage and processing
  • Integrated Ethernet MAC controller simplifies network connectivity

Disadvantages

  • Limited flash memory capacity compared to some other microcontrollers
  • Relatively higher cost compared to lower-end microcontrollers
  • Steeper learning curve for beginners due to advanced features and complexity

Working Principles

The LM3S617-IGZ50-C2T operates based on the principles of a microcontroller. It executes instructions stored in its flash memory, processes data using its ARM Cortex-M3 core, communicates with external devices through various interfaces, and controls the overall system operation.

Detailed Application Field Plans

The LM3S617-IGZ50-C2T finds applications in a wide range of fields, including but not limited to: - Industrial automation - Consumer electronics - Internet of Things (IoT) devices - Medical equipment - Automotive systems - Robotics

Detailed and Complete Alternative Models

Some alternative models that offer similar functionalities to the LM3S617-IGZ50-C2T include: - STM32F407VG - PIC32MX795F512L - MSP430F5529 - LPC1768

These alternatives provide comparable performance and features, allowing designers to choose the most suitable microcontroller for their specific application requirements.

In conclusion, the LM3S617-IGZ50-C2T is a high-performance microcontroller with advanced features, making it suitable for a wide range of applications. Its compact size, low power consumption, and versatile interfaces make it an attractive choice for embedded system designs.

Noem 10 veelgestelde vragen en antwoorden met betrekking tot de toepassing van LM3S617-IGZ50-C2T in technische oplossingen

Sure! Here are 10 common questions and answers related to the application of LM3S617-IGZ50-C2T in technical solutions:

  1. Question: What is LM3S617-IGZ50-C2T?
    Answer: LM3S617-IGZ50-C2T is a microcontroller from Texas Instruments' Stellaris family, specifically designed for embedded applications.

  2. Question: What are the key features of LM3S617-IGZ50-C2T?
    Answer: Some key features include a 32-bit ARM Cortex-M3 core, 50 MHz clock speed, 256 KB flash memory, 64 KB RAM, and various peripherals like UART, SPI, I2C, ADC, etc.

  3. Question: What are the typical applications of LM3S617-IGZ50-C2T?
    Answer: LM3S617-IGZ50-C2T is commonly used in applications such as industrial automation, motor control, home appliances, medical devices, and IoT solutions.

  4. Question: How can I program LM3S617-IGZ50-C2T?
    Answer: You can program LM3S617-IGZ50-C2T using software development tools like Keil MDK, Code Composer Studio, or Energia IDE, which support ARM Cortex-M microcontrollers.

  5. Question: Can I connect external sensors or devices to LM3S617-IGZ50-C2T?
    Answer: Yes, LM3S617-IGZ50-C2T has multiple GPIO pins and various communication interfaces (UART, SPI, I2C) that allow you to connect and interface with external sensors or devices.

  6. Question: Does LM3S617-IGZ50-C2T support real-time operating systems (RTOS)?
    Answer: Yes, LM3S617-IGZ50-C2T is compatible with popular RTOS like FreeRTOS, uC/OS-II, and embOS, which can help in developing complex multitasking applications.

  7. Question: What kind of power supply does LM3S617-IGZ50-C2T require?
    Answer: LM3S617-IGZ50-C2T typically operates at a voltage range of 2.7V to 3.6V, so you need to provide a regulated power supply within this range.

  8. Question: Can I debug my code running on LM3S617-IGZ50-C2T?
    Answer: Yes, LM3S617-IGZ50-C2T supports various debugging interfaces like JTAG and SWD, allowing you to debug your code using tools like J-Link or Stellaris In-Circuit Debug Interface (ICDI).

  9. Question: Are there any development boards available for LM3S617-IGZ50-C2T?
    Answer: Yes, Texas Instruments provides development kits like the Stellaris LM3S6965 Evaluation Board, which includes LM3S617-IGZ50-C2T microcontroller, along with other necessary components for easy prototyping.

  10. Question: Where can I find more resources and documentation for LM3S617-IGZ50-C2T?
    Answer: You can find detailed datasheets, application notes, and user guides for LM3S617-IGZ50-C2T on the official Texas Instruments website, as well as online forums and communities dedicated to embedded systems and microcontrollers.